The Bantams will be looking to make it back-to-back wins at the Utilita Energy Stadium this Saturday when they welcome Bristol Rovers in Sky Bet League Two.

The Gas have drawn only one game so far this season, winning four and losing six, while no side outside of the relegation zone has conceded more than the Pirates so far.

We have put together an Opposition Guide to give you all the information you need to know about our 12th opponent of the season.

TRANSFER ACTIVITY

The Pirates utilised the transfer window heavily this summer, with the club letting go of 22 players and bringing in 17 fresh faces - including former Premier League midfielder Glenn Whelan.

ONES TO WATCH

Leon Clarke

Former Wolves and Sheffield United striker Leon Clarke joined the Pirates in summer and has scored once in two appearances. 

Clarke's move to Bristol Rovers was the 23rd of his career, and the 36-year-old still knows where the back of the net is - scoring the winner on his debut for the club against Crawley Town.

Paul Coutts 

Another summer signing, Coutts has spent the majority of his career at Championship level.

The 33-year-old is best known for a right foot which has earnt him plaudits for his range of passing and set-pieces.

Coutts joined the Gas to re-join former manager Joey Barton, and has made seven league appearances under him this season.

Brett Pitman 

Former Bournemouth man Pitman has made seven appearances for Bristol Rovers this season, netting once.

The frontman scored 101 goals for the Cherries across three appearances and joined the Pirates on a free transfer from Swindon, after scoring 11 goals in 37 appearances.

CAPTAIN

Paul Coutts captains the Gas despite only joining the club this summer.

Following the departure of former captains Max Ehmer and Luke Leahy, new manager Joey Barton had to elect his on-field leader at the start of the season.

The veteran midfielder’s previous experience with manager Barton accelerated his seniority in the squad and he now captains his new side.

MANAGER

Former Newcastle, Manchester City and QPR midfielder Joey Barton is the man in charge at the Memorial Stadium.

Barton took the managerial post at the Gas in February this year, with the side languishing in the relegation zone of Sky Bet League One.
